
Toronto Argonauts Announce 2014 Schedule
Published on February 12, 2014 under Canadian Football League (CFL)
Toronto Argonauts News Release
Toronto - The Toronto Argonauts' 2014 schedule will offer fans an exciting home schedule highlighted by more weekend games and an action-packed Fall during the crucial CFL playoff run!
The Argos will play eight regular season home games on Friday, Saturday or Sunday, all of which include a good combination of both prime time and family-friendly kickoff times at Rogers Centre. Games will be balanced throughout the Summer months as fans prepare for the thrill of live, hard hitting football that will feature even more East Division rivalry match-ups as the CFL officially welcomes the Ottawa REDBLACKS! Argonauts fans will be thrilled to know that their team will revisit their historic roots as they return to the hallowed grounds at Varsity Stadium for their home pre-season game against rival Hamilton Tiger-Cats.
A potent offence helped power the Toronto Argonauts to the top of the East Division standings last season. Led by reigning East Division Most Outstanding Player, QB Ricky Ray, the high powered unit put up more than 500 points for the first time in over a decade. Fans will get their first glimpse of this year's offence live at the 2014 Home Opener on Saturday, July 5 when the Double Blue welcome the reigning Grey Cup champion Saskatchewan Roughriders.
Double Blue supporters can be part of history twice this year on the road. A special fan train will leave Toronto for the inaugural game in our nation's capital where the Argos will take on the REDBLACKS on July 18. Then, the Labour Day Classic is back in Hamilton on September 1 as two storied foes renew their rivalry at the new Tim Hortons Field. More details for both games, and how fans can be involved, are available by calling 416-341-2746 (ARGO).
The following is the Toronto Argonauts 2014 home schedule:
DATE OPPONENT TIME
Pre-Season
Thursday, June 19 Hamilton Tiger-Cats 7:00 p.m. (Varsity Stadium)
Regular Season
Saturday, July 5 Saskatchewan Roughriders 3:00 p.m
Saturday, July 12 Calgary Stampeders 6:30 p.m.
Tuesday, August 12 Winnipeg Blue Bombers 7:30 p.m.
Sunday, August 17 B.C. Lions 7:30 p.m.
Saturday, October 4 Edmonton Eskimos 4:00 p.m.
Friday, October 10 Hamilton Tiger-Cats 7:00 p.m.
Saturday, October 18 Montreal Alouettes 4:00 p.m.
Saturday, October 25 Hamilton Tiger-Cats 4:00 p.m.
Friday, November 7 Ottawa REDBLACKS 7:00 p.m.
